We're high in the Italian Alps, in Castlerotto -- a town I love because it's right in the midst of mountain splendor, yet doesn't have that empty ski-resort-in-the-summer feeling. Our hotel -- the Cavallino d'Oro -- is a great example of the Italian/German mix characteristic of this region (the Dolomites, in the far north of Italy). Our group is just finishing up breakfast before loading up the bus. And just outside the door of our hotel is the cobbled town square. For our tours, we favor hotels where the charm of Europe is literally at your doorstep.
